OpenAssets, Itaú Join 50-Firm ANBIMA Tokenization Pilot in Brazil

2 articles · Updated · PR Newswire · Aug 11

Summary

  • OpenAssets and Itaú said they will work together in ANBIMA's tokenization pilot to test digital-asset use cases in Brazil's capital markets.
  • The project focuses on fixed-income instruments and investment funds, using OpenAssets' infrastructure and Itaú's market expertise to build proofs of concept and assess architecture, standards, operations and compliance.
  • ANBIMA's pilot is testing the full lifecycle of tokenized securities on DLT networks — issuance, trading and settlement — to standardize how instruments such as debentures and funds are handled.
  • More than 50 financial and capital-markets organizations are participating, underscoring Brazil's push to move tokenization from early experimentation toward production-grade market infrastructure.
